Research Associate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Florida

Florida's research associate jobs span pharmaceutical and biotech firms in Miami and Tampa, marine and environmental science institutes along the coast, and major research universities including the University of Florida and University of Miami. Employers across these sectors have established track records of sponsoring international candidates for research roles requiring specialized scientific training.

Research Associate Jobs in Florida: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for research associates in Florida?

Major sponsors for research associate roles in Florida include Johnson and Johnson's Florida operations, Moffitt Cancer Center in Tampa, Scripps Research in Jupiter, and the University of Florida's research divisions. Marine science organizations such as Harbor Branch Oceanographic Institute also sponsor international researchers. University-affiliated medical centers across Miami, Gainesville, and Orlando are among the most consistent sponsors in the state.

Which visa types are most common for research associate roles in Florida?

The H-1B is the most common visa for research associates in Florida, as most positions require at least a bachelor's degree in a specific scientific field, meeting the specialty occupation standard. Research associates at universities or nonprofit research institutions may qualify for cap-exempt H-1B petitions. J-1 exchange visitor visas are also common for postdoctoral and institutional research positions, particularly at Florida's public universities.

Which cities in Florida have the most research associate sponsorship jobs?

Miami leads for pharmaceutical, biotech, and clinical research associate roles, supported by a dense concentration of life sciences employers and the University of Miami Health System. Tampa is a strong second, anchored by Moffitt Cancer Center and the University of South Florida. Gainesville hosts significant academic research activity through the University of Florida, and Jupiter has emerged as a biomedical research hub through Scripps Research and Max Planck Florida Institute.

Are there any Florida-specific considerations for research associates seeking visa sponsorship?

Florida's strong university pipeline means many research associate openings are affiliated with institutions that hold blanket H-1B cap exemptions, which can meaningfully change your timeline compared to cap-subject petitions. The state's growing biotech and pharmaceutical sectors, especially around Miami-Dade and the Palm Beach research corridor, attract significant NIH and private funding, which correlates with consistent international hiring. Prevailing wage compliance is determined by the specific county and occupational classification, so the required wage floor will differ between, for example, Alachua County and Miami-Dade County.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ored research associate jobs in Florida?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
